- Franchise Original Sin: This episode portrays Skarloey with a defeatist attitude regarding the repair of the Skarloey Railway, which contradicts the Determinator aspect of his personality in the previous two seasons. As The Unlucky Tug pointed out in his "Sodor's Finest" episode dedicated to Skarloey, this marked the beginning of the Little Old Engine's infamous character derailment, until he was rerailed during the Brenner era. "The Old Bridge" is controversial for portraying Skarloey as Out of Character, but since it was shown that he suffered a traumatic experience and was reacting to it, some fans are more forgiving. However, during the HiT era, Skarloey regressed to a child for no good reason beyond HiT thinking he must be a child because he's a small narrow gauge engine, with predictably disastrous results.
